Our VISION The International Kundalini Yoga Teachers Association (IKYTA) is a global community of KRI-certified Kundalini Yoga teachers, committed to empowering people to realize their highest potential. Founded in 1994, IKYTA has grown into a network of teachers in over 40 countries. Sharing the transformative power of Kundalini Yoga...
